Why Electric Scooter Weight Matters
The weight of an electric scooter affects multiple aspects of its usability. A heavier scooter may offer better stability and durability, but it can also be a hassle to carry upstairs or onto public transport. On the other hand, a lightweight model might be easier to handle but could sacrifice battery life or speed. Understanding these trade-offs is key to making an informed decision.
How Weight Impacts Performance
Heavier scooters often come with larger batteries, which can extend range but also increase overall weight. This can lead to slower acceleration and reduced top speed, especially on inclines. Lighter models, while zippier, may struggle with long distances or rough terrain. The ideal weight depends on your priorities—speed, range, or portability.
Portability and Convenience
If you plan to carry your scooter frequently, weight becomes a critical factor. Models under 30 pounds are easy to lift, while those over 40 pounds may require extra effort. Folding mechanisms also play a role—some scooters are designed to be compact, making them easier to store in tight spaces.
Safety and Stability Considerations
A heavier scooter tends to feel more stable at higher speeds, reducing wobble and improving control. However, if you’re not strong enough to handle the weight, maneuvering it could become a safety risk. Always test a scooter’s weight before purchasing to ensure it matches your physical capabilities.
Finding the Right Balance
The best electric scooter weight depends on your lifestyle. Commuters might prefer a mid-weight model (25-35 lbs) for a mix of portability and performance. Recreational riders could opt for heavier scooters with extended range.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ications and read reviews to gauge real-world usability.
